Listeria starts when L. monocytogenes contaminates food, keeps growing in the fridge, then gets eaten. Listeria isn’t a “mystery illness.” It has a clear cause: a bacterium called Listeria monocytogenes. Most Thanksgiving dinners center on roast turkey with gravy, stuffing or dressing, mashed potatoes, a vegetable side, cranberry sauce, rolls, and pumpkin pie.
